1972 Storm Names
Western North Pacific tropical cyclones were named by the Joint Typhoon Warning Center. The first storm of 1972 was named Kit and the final one was named Violet.

Two Central Pacific system developed, Tropical Storms June and Ruby. The policy at the time was to use Western Pacific names the Central Pacific.
